What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Munich to Toronto?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Munich to Toronto Pearson Intl Airport cl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

For Munich to Toronto, Wednesday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Saturday is the most expensive. Flying from Toronto back to Munich, the best deals are generally found on Wednesday, with Thursday being the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Munich to Toronto Pearson Intl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Munich to Toronto Pearson Intl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Munich to Toronto Pearson Intl Airport is May, where tickets cost 577 € (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are January and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is 977 € and 738 € resp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Munich to Toronto Pearson Intl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Munich to Toronto Pearson Intl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Munich to Toronto Pearson Intl Airport,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 16%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 13 weeks before departure.

  • Which airports will I be using when flying from Munich to Toronto?

    Munich and Toronto are both served by 1 main airport. You will leave Munich from Munich Franz Josef Strauss and will be arriving at Toronto Pearson Intl.

  • Which airlines offer Wi-Fi service onboard planes from Munich to Toronto?

    All the following airlines offer inflight Wi-Fi service on the Munich to Toronto flight route: Lufthansa, Air Canada, United Airlines, Virgin Atlantic, KLM, Delta, Air France, and Austrian Airlines.

  • Which aircraft models fly most regularly from Munich to Toronto?

    The Airbus A350-900 is the aircraft model that flies most regularly on the Munich to Toronto flight route.

  • Which airline alliances offer flights from Munich to Toronto?

    Star Alliance is the only airline alliance operating flights between Munich and Toronto.

  • On which days can I fly direct from Munich to Toronto?

    There are direct flights from Munich to Toronto on a daily basis.
